Wiring check
Fault finding problems
Disconnecting the connectors and/or manipulating the wiring harness may temporarily remove the cause of a fault.
Electrical measurements of voltage, resistance and insulation are generally correct, especially if the fault is not
present when the analysis is made (stored fault).
Visual inspection
Look for damage under the bonnet and in the passenger compartment.
Carefully check the fuses, insulators and wiring harness routing.
Look for signs of oxidation.
Tactile inspection
While manipulating the wiring harness, use the diagnostic tool to note any change in fault status from stored to
present.
Make sure that the connectors are properly locked.
Apply light pressure to the connectors.
Twist the wiring harness.
If there is a change in status, try to locate the source of the fault.
Inspection of each component
Disconnect the connectors and check the appearance of the clips and tabs, as well as the crimping (no crimping on
the insulating section).
Make sure that the clips and tabs are properly locked in the sockets.
Check that no clips or tabs have been dislodged during connection.
Check the clip contact pressure using an appropriate model of tab.
Resistance check
Check the continuity of entire lines, then section by section.
Look for a short circuit to earth, to + 12 V or to another wire.
If a fault is detected, repair or replace the wiring harness.

Fault finding - Function
DEACTIVATING THE SYSTEM
–The parking proximity sensor system can be deactivated in two ways:
–Temporary deactivation: briefly pressing (1 second) the parking distance control switch on the instrument panel
deactivates the system (the red warning light on the switch comes on). The function can be switched on again by
pressing briefly for a second time (the red indicator light on the switch goes out) or by switching the ignition off and
back on.
–Permanent deactivation: The parking distance control system can be deactivated for a longer period by
pressing and holding (for approximately 3 seconds) the parking distance control switch on the instrument panel
(the red warning light on the switch comes on). The function can be switched on again only by pressing and
holding the switch again (the red warning light on the switch goes out).
Fault finding:
In the event of a system fault, the driver will be alerted by a 5-second continuous warning sound with a
different pitch to the detection signal.Note:
The diagnostic tool statuses can be used to determine the function status (ready, detecting, suspended or
deactivated) by using status ET003 Parking distance control function (see Conformity check or the relevant
status interpretation).

Fault finding - Fault summary table
Summary of components on which fault finding can be performed by the parking distance control computer
(the associated DTC column corresponds to the Design Office codes)
Tool fault Associated DTC Diagnostic tool title
DF002 9001Left-hand outer sensor
DF003 9002Left-hand inner sensor
DF004 9004Right-hand outer sensor
DF005 9003Right-hand inner sensor
DF006 9006Buzzer
DF007 9007Sensor feed voltage
DF008 9005Computer fault
DF012 9010Parking proximity sensor switch indicator light

Fault finding - Interpretation of faults
DF002
PRESENT
OR
STOREDLEFT-HAND OUTER SENSOR
CC.1 : Short circuit to + 12 V
CO.0 : Open circuit or short circuit to earth
1.DEF : Internal electronic fault
NOTESConditions for applying the fault finding procedure to stored faults:
The fault is declared present following selection of reverse gear if the parking proximity
sensor function is ACTIVE (READY): the parking proximity sensor warning light is not
lit, see the interpretation of status ET003 Parking proximity sensor function.
Special notes:
This fault is indicated by the buzzer (a 5 second warning sound) and the system shuts
down.
CC.1
CO.0
NOTES None
Remove the rear bumper and disconnect the 3-track connector on the left-hand outer sensor.
Check for possible damage to the wiring harness, check the condition and connection of the parking distance
control computer and left-hand outer sensor connectors (bent, oxidised or broken tabs).
If the connection is faulty and there is a repair procedure (see Technical Note 6015A, Electrical wiring repair,
Wiring: Precautions for repair), repair the wiring, otherwise replace it.
Switch off the ignition and disconnect the computer's 16-track connector.
Measure the internal resistances of computer component code 12022 between the following connections:
●Connection code 151C,
●Connection code 151U.
The resistance must be 215 kΩΩ Ω Ω
± 10 kΩΩ Ω Ω
.
●Connection code 151C,
●Connection code 151V.
The resistance must be 100 kΩΩ Ω Ω
± 5 kΩΩ Ω Ω
.
If the readings do not correspond to the above values or if there is a short circuit in the specified connections,
contact Techline.
AFTER REPAIRClear the stored faults.
Follow the instructions to confirm repair.
Deal with any other faults.

DF003
PRESENT
OR
STOREDLEFT-HAND INNER SENSOR
CC.1 : Short circuit to + 12 V
CO.0 : Open circuit or short circuit to earth
1.DEF : Internal electronic fault
NOTESConditions for applying the fault finding procedure to stored faults:
The fault is declared present following selection of reverse gear if the parking proximity
sensor function is ACTIVE (READY): the parking proximity sensor warning light is not
lit, see the interpretation of status ET003 Parking proximity sensor function.
Special notes:
This fault is indicated by the buzzer (a 5 second warning sound) and the system shuts
down.
CC.1
CO.0
NOTES None
Remove the rear bumper and disconnect the 3-track connector on the left-hand inner detection sensor.
Check for possible damage to the wiring harness, check the condition and connection of the parking distance
control computer and left hand inner sensor connectors (bent, oxidised or broken tabs).
If the connection is faulty (see Technical Note 6015A, Electrical wiring repair, Wiring: Precautions for repair),
repair the wiring, or replace it.
Switch off the ignition and disconnect the computer's 16-track connector.
Measure the internal resistances of the computer between the following connections:
●Connection code 151M,
●Connection code 151U.
The resistance must be 215 kΩΩ Ω Ω
± 10 kΩΩ Ω Ω
.
●Connection code 151M,
●Connection code 151V.
The resistance must be 100 kΩΩ Ω Ω
± 5 kΩΩ Ω Ω
.
If the readings do not correspond to the above values or if there is a short circuit in the specified connections,
contact Techline.
Measure the resistance of component 1221 between the following connections:
●Connection code 151M,
●Connection code 151U.
If the resistance value is not infinite, replace the left-hand inner sensor.
●Connection code 151M,
●Connection code 151V.
If the resistance is not 40 kΩΩ Ω Ω
± 5 kΩΩ Ω Ω
(wait a few seconds for the reading to stabilise), replace the left-hand inner
sensor.
AFTER REPAIRClear the stored faults.
Follow the instructions to confirm repair.
Deal with any other faults.

DF006
PRESENT
OR
STOREDBUZZER
CC.1 : Short circuit to + 12 V
CO.0 : Open circuit or short circuit to earth
NOTESConditions for applying the fault finding procedure to stored faults:
The fault is declared present following selection of reverse gear if the parking proximity
sensor function is ACTIVE (READY): the parking proximity sensor warning light is not
lit, see the interpretation of status ET003 Parking proximity sensor function.
Special notes:
The fault is indicated by the absence of the 1-second beep normally emitted by the
buzzer when reverse gear is selected.
Check for possible damage to the wiring harness, check the condition and connection of the parking distance
control computer and the buzzer connectors (bent, oxidised or broken tabs).
If the connection is faulty and there is a repair procedure (see Technical Note 6015A, Electrical wiring repair,
Wiring: Precautions for repair), repair the wiring, otherwise replace it.
Switch off the ignition and disconnect the 16 track connector from computer component code 1222.
Measure the internal resistance of the computer between the following connections:
●Connection code 151R.
●Connection code 151S
Between components 1222 and 1223.
If the measured value is not 314 ΩΩ Ω Ω
± 10 ΩΩ Ω Ω
or if there is a short circuit on the specified connections, contact Techline.
Switch off the ignition, and disconnect the parking distance control computer to check the insulation, continuity
and the absence of interference resistance on the following connections:
●Connection code 151R,
●Connection code 151S.
Between components 1222 and 1223.
If the connection or connections are faulty and if there is a repair procedure (see Technical Note 6015A, Electrical
wiring repair, Wiring: Precautions for repair), repair the wiring or replace it.
Measure the resistance value of component 1223 between the following connections:
Measure the resistance between the following connections:
●Connection code 151R,
●Connection code 151S.
Replace the buzzer if its resistance value is not approximately 48 ΩΩ Ω Ω
± 5 ΩΩ Ω Ω
.
If the fault is still present, replace the buzzer.
AFTER REPAIRClear the stored faults.
Follow the instructions to confirm repair.
Deal with any other faults.
